Editor’s Note: Our First Issue

  A New Bridge in the Study of the Arab World

 We are delighted to welcome our readers to the first issue of the electronic journal the International Journal for Arab Studies (IJAS). As a co-founding editor I am honoured to introduce the first editorial note with enthusiasm. We begin this new e-journal by asking a question, why IJAS now? We believe this e-journal will bring a unique academic approach from existing journals, electronic or print, contributing to an ongoing dialogue among scholars from the Arab World and the West....
